基于MODIS 数据的悬浮泥沙定量遥感方法

摘    要:以黄海及东海海域为对象,研究用MOD IS数据提取我国海域悬浮泥沙时空分布的定量遥感方法,建立了基于MOD IS数据的悬浮泥沙定量遥感实用模式。研究表明,用250 m和1 000 m分辨率的MOD IS数据进行悬浮泥沙浓度的定量遥感,可以达到实际应用的精度要求。这说明,MOD IS数据是研究近岸水体中悬浮物输运变化规律的一种经济实用数据源。

THE APPLICATION OF MODIS IMAGERY TO MAPPING CONCENTRATIONS OF SUSPENDED SEDIMENTS IN COASTAL WATERS

Abstract:Suspended sediments constitute an important component of water color,and high concentrations of suspended particulate matter in coastal waters directly affect or control numerous water column and benthic processes.In this paper,the utility of MODIS 250 m and 1 000 m data for analyzing turbid coastal waters was examined in the Yellow Sea and the East China Sea.With a set of processing procedures,the authors used MODIS images in the 250 m model and the 1 000 m model to map the concentrations of suspended sediments.The results were compared with the in-situ data set collected in April 2003.This study demonstrates that the moderately high resolution of MODIS 250 m data is useful in examining the evolutionary process of materials in coastal environments,particularly the smaller water bodies such as bays and estuaries,and that the 1000 m data are perfect in mapping the concentrations of suspended matter in open coastal waters.
